Sat 781482069339173

decimal
156296.2069339173
degree
0°156296′1064″2069339173‴
percentile
37.21343191422874%
name
ihuwyrbuigi
cycle
0
epoch
0
period
77
block
156296
offset
2069339173
timestamp
rarity
common